Output f2105863b7f4d17ad0ef7f5a2bf287512ed535a0423558fca689d8c7561a5314:0

value
89035155
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ad975841d8fed72bd64860ca161239713ccd98e OP_EQUALVERIFY OP_CHECKSIG
address
17pmWWsEZJtuGDc9EaEVuikxne44fhxW6K
transaction
f2105863b7f4d17ad0ef7f5a2bf287512ed535a0423558fca689d8c7561a5314
spent
true